ABOUT YOU
Xsolla is looking for a commercially minded and proactive Legal Counsel to support the
continued global expansion of our network of payment service providers (PSPs). This role
will focus on structuring, drafting, and negotiating agreements with payment partners
and providing legal support for global payment operations.

You will play a critical role in helping the company scale its payment infrastructure across
multiple markets, enabling millions of users to pay seamlessly in games around the world.
This is a unique opportunity to join a dynamic legal team at the intersection of tech,
gaming, and digital commerce.

Responsibilities

    • Legal Support for Payment Expansion:
    • Advise on legal matters related to onboarding and maintaining relationships with PSPs, acquirers, payment gateways, and financial institutions.
    • Provide strategic input on the legal aspects of entering new markets and structuring payment flows.
    • Contract Negotiation and Management:
    • Draft, review, and negotiate commercial contracts with payment providers, ensuring alignment with business objectives and compliance requirements.
    • Develop and maintain standardized agreement templates and negotiation playbooks.
    • Regulatory & Risk Awareness:
    • Monitor and interpret applicable legal and regulatory developments related to payment services (e.g., AML, KYC, card scheme rules, sanctions compliance).
    • Coordinate with internal stakeholders to ensure adherence to local legal standards during PSP integrations.
    • Cross-Functional Collaboration:
    • Partner with business development, product, compliance, and finance teams to support fast and compliant expansion of the payments network.
    • Help launch new payment methods and support product teams with legal input during implementation.
    • Stakeholder & External Party Engagement:
    • Liaise with external parties and build strong, trust-based relationships with payment partners and financial service providers.

Qualifications & Skills

    • Experience & Expertise:
    • Minimum 5 years of legal experience, ideally in a combination of in-house and law firm settings.
    • Strong background in commercial contracts and experience working with payment systems or in the broader fintech or gaming sectors.
    • Familiarity with global payment service structures and commercial terms.
    • Skills & Attributes:
    • Excellent contract drafting and negotiation skills in English (Advanced/C1+).
    • Detail-oriented and able to balance legal risk with business priorities.
    • Strong interpersonal and communication skills, capable of working across functions and cultures.
    • Self-driven, organized, and comfortable managing multiple projects simultaneously in a fast-paced, international environment.
